服务器租赁计算公式,服务器租赁计算
- 综合资讯
- 2024-10-01 00:56:06
- 5

请提供一下关于服务器租赁计算公式以及服务器租赁计算相关的具体内容,这样我才能生成摘要。...
请提供一下关于服务器租赁计算公式、服务器租赁计算的具体内容,这样我才能生成相应的摘要。
本文目录导读:
《服务器租赁计算全解析:深入探究成本、性能与选择策略》
在当今数字化时代,服务器租赁已经成为众多企业和创业者开展业务的重要选择,无论是小型创业公司搭建网站,还是大型企业部署复杂的企业级应用,了解服务器租赁计算都是至关重要的,这不仅有助于控制成本,还能确保所租赁的服务器满足业务的性能需求,本文将深入探讨服务器租赁计算的各个方面,从基础的计算公式到复杂的性能权衡,为读者提供全面而详细的指导。
服务器租赁的基本成本构成
1、硬件成本
- 服务器类型
- 塔式服务器通常适合小型企业或办公室环境,其成本相对较低,入门级塔式服务器可能价格在几千元到一、两万元不等,这类服务器的计算能力和存储容量适合处理一些基本的办公应用,如文件共享、小型数据库管理等。
- 机架式服务器是数据中心常见的选择,根据其配置不同,价格差异较大,中低端的机架式服务器价格可能在两万元到五万元左右,而高端的企业级机架式服务器,配备强大的处理器、大容量内存和高速存储,价格可能超过十万元。
- 刀片式服务器则更适合高密度计算环境,如大型数据中心,由于其模块化设计和高效的空间利用,刀片式服务器的成本相对较高,一套完整的刀片式服务器系统,包括刀片服务器机箱、刀片服务器模块以及相关的管理模块等,价格可能在数十万元。
- CPU性能
- CPU的核心数、频率等因素直接影响服务器的计算能力和租赁成本,一颗普通的双核心CPU的服务器租赁成本可能相对较低,而具有多核心(如8核心、16核心甚至更多)且高频率的CPU的服务器,由于其强大的计算能力,租赁价格会显著提高,以Intel Xeon系列CPU为例,采用E - 2200系列的服务器可能比采用更高级别的Platinum系列的服务器租赁价格低很多,因为Platinum系列在核心数、缓存大小和睿频能力等方面都有更出色的表现。
- 内存容量
- 服务器内存容量从几GB到数TB不等,入门级服务器可能配备8GB或16GB内存,租赁价格相对较低,随着内存容量的增加,如32GB、64GB甚至128GB或更高,租赁成本也会相应增加,这是因为大容量内存可以支持更多的并发应用运行、处理更大的数据量,适用于数据库服务器、虚拟化环境等对内存要求较高的场景。
- 存储设备
- 硬盘类型(HDD或SSD)和容量对服务器租赁成本有很大影响,传统的机械硬盘(HDD)容量大且价格相对较低,适合存储大量数据但读写速度较慢,一块1TB的HDD成本可能在几百元,而同样容量的固态硬盘(SSD)价格可能在一千多元,在服务器租赁中,如果选择以HDD为主的存储方案,租赁成本会低于以SSD为主的方案,对于需要高速读写的应用,如数据库事务处理、高性能计算中的临时数据存储等,SSD是更好的选择,虽然租赁成本较高。
- 存储阵列的配置也会影响成本,RAID(独立磁盘冗余阵列)技术可以提供数据冗余和性能提升,RAID 0可以提高读写速度但没有数据冗余,RAID 1提供数据镜像有较好的冗余性但存储利用率只有50%,而RAID 5、RAID 6等则在数据冗余和存储利用率之间取得不同的平衡,配置不同的RAID级别会涉及到不同的硬件成本和管理成本,从而影响服务器租赁价格。
2、软件成本
- 操作系统
- 选择不同的操作系统会有不同的成本,Linux操作系统(如CentOS、Ubuntu等)大多是开源免费的,这可以降低服务器租赁成本,而Windows Server操作系统则需要购买许可证,其价格根据不同版本和许可证类型有所不同,Windows Server Standard版本的许可证价格可能在数千元,企业版则更贵,对于一些依赖特定Windows应用程序(如Microsoft SQL Server等)的企业,可能不得不选择Windows Server操作系统,从而增加了软件成本。
- 应用程序软件
- 如果服务器需要运行特定的商业应用程序软件,如数据库管理系统(Oracle Database、Microsoft SQL Server等)、企业资源规划(ERP)软件(如SAP等),这些软件的许可证成本也需要考虑,Oracle Database的许可证费用根据不同的版本、功能模块和用户数量等因素而定,可能是一笔相当可观的费用,这会显著增加服务器租赁的总成本。
- 虚拟化软件
- 如果采用虚拟化技术(如VMware、Hyper - V等)来提高服务器资源利用率,虚拟化软件的许可证成本也需要计算在内,VMware vSphere的许可证价格根据不同的功能集和许可模式有所不同,对于大型企业数据中心来说,这是一笔不可忽视的成本。
3、网络成本
- 带宽
- 服务器租赁的网络带宽是一个重要的成本因素,低带宽(如10Mbps)的租赁价格相对较低,适合小型网站或对网络流量要求不高的应用,而对于大型电商网站、视频流媒体平台等需要处理大量网络流量的应用,则需要更高的带宽,如100Mbps、1Gbps甚至10Gbps或更高,随着带宽的增加,租赁成本也会呈阶梯式上升,10Mbps带宽的月租赁费用可能在几百元,而1Gbps带宽的月租赁费用可能在数千元。
- IP地址
- 额外的IP地址需求也会增加成本,服务器租赁套餐可能包含一个或几个基本的IP地址,如果需要更多的公网IP地址(如用于负载均衡、多域名绑定等),则需要额外付费,每个额外IP地址的月费用可能在几十元到上百元不等。
服务器租赁成本计算的公式
1、简单成本计算公式
- 服务器租赁月成本(C)=硬件租赁成本(H)+软件租赁成本(S)+网络租赁成本(N)
- 硬件租赁成本(H):根据服务器的类型、配置(CPU、内存、存储等)以及租赁时长来确定,如果一台中低端机架式服务器的硬件购置成本为3万元,租赁公司按照3年折旧计算(假设每年工作12个月),则每月的硬件租赁成本约为833元(30000/(3×12))。
- 软件租赁成本(S):包括操作系统、应用程序软件和虚拟化软件等的许可证费用分摊到每月的成本,如果Windows Server Standard许可证费用为5000元,按照3年使用期计算,每月的软件成本约为139元(5000/(3×12))。
- 网络租赁成本(N):由带宽费用和额外IP地址费用等组成,如100Mbps带宽月费用为1000元,2个额外IP地址月费用为100元,则网络租赁成本为1100元。
2、考虑资源利用率的成本计算公式
- 在实际情况中,为了更精确地计算服务器租赁成本,需要考虑资源利用率,假设服务器的硬件资源(如CPU、内存、存储等)总价值为V,实际使用的资源比例为U(0 < U≤1),则硬件租赁成本(H')= H×U。
- 一台服务器的硬件总价值为5万元,每月硬件租赁成本按照简单计算为1389元(50000/(3×12)),如果通过监控发现CPU利用率平均为50%,内存利用率为60%,存储利用率为40%,可以根据一定的权重计算出综合资源利用率U(假设权重相同,U=(0.5 + 0.6+0.4)/3 = 0.5),则调整后的硬件租赁成本H'=1389×0.5 = 694.5元。
性能与成本的权衡
1、性能指标
- CPU性能指标
- 除了核心数和频率外,还需要考虑CPU的指令集、缓存大小等因素,具有AVX - 512指令集的CPU在处理向量计算时具有更高的效率,适合用于科学计算、人工智能等领域,较大的缓存(如三级缓存)可以减少CPU访问内存的次数,提高数据读取速度,在租赁服务器时,如果应用对CPU性能要求较高,如视频编码、3D渲染等,可能需要选择具有更先进CPU特性的服务器,虽然成本较高。
- 内存性能指标
- 内存的频率、延迟等会影响服务器的整体性能,高频率的内存可以更快地与CPU进行数据交互,低延迟的内存可以减少数据等待时间,DDR4内存相比DDR3内存在频率和性能上有很大提升,对于内存密集型应用(如内存数据库),选择高频率、低延迟的内存是提高性能的关键,但这也会增加租赁成本。
- 存储性能指标
- 对于硬盘,除了读写速度外,还需要考虑IOPS(每秒输入/输出操作次数),SSD的IOPS通常比HDD高很多,尤其是企业级的NVMe SSD,其IOPS可以达到数十万甚至更高,在数据库事务处理中,高IOPS可以大大提高系统的响应速度,如果应用对存储性能要求极高,如金融交易系统,选择高性能的存储设备虽然会增加服务器租赁成本,但可以提高系统的整体性能和可靠性。
2、性能与成本的平衡策略
- 性能预估
- 在租赁服务器之前,需要对应用的性能需求进行准确预估,对于一个预计每天有1万独立访客的网站,可以通过性能测试工具(如Apache JMeter等)模拟用户访问,估算出所需的CPU、内存和网络带宽等资源,如果预估不准确,可能会导致租赁的服务器性能不足(影响用户体验)或者性能过剩(增加不必要的成本)。
- 可扩展性
- 选择具有可扩展性的服务器租赁方案可以在一定程度上平衡性能和成本,一些云服务提供商提供可弹性扩展的服务器资源,当业务量增长时,可以方便地增加CPU、内存或带宽等资源,而当业务量减少时,可以相应地减少资源使用,从而降低成本,这种按使用量付费的模式可以避免一次性租赁过高配置服务器带来的成本浪费。
- 混合配置
- 对于一些复杂的应用场景,可以采用混合配置的方式,将对性能要求极高的应用组件(如数据库服务器中的关键事务处理模块)部署在高性能的服务器上,而将一些对性能要求相对较低的辅助应用(如日志分析、备份服务等)部署在较低配置的服务器上,这样可以在满足整体性能需求的同时,降低服务器租赁的总成本。
不同租赁模式下的成本计算
1、传统托管式租赁
- 在传统托管式租赁中,企业将自己购买的服务器放置在数据中心托管,成本包括服务器购置成本、托管费用(包括机房空间、电力、网络接入等),托管费用根据机房的等级(如T3、T4级机房)、服务器占用的空间(以U为单位,1U = 4.445cm)以及所需的电力和网络资源而定,一个1U服务器在普通T3级机房的托管月费用可能在500 - 1000元左右,其中包括一定的电力和10Mbps带宽,如果服务器需要更多的电力(如高性能服务器的功耗较大)或者更高的带宽,托管费用会相应增加。
2、云服务器租赁
- 云服务器租赁采用按需付费的模式,成本计算相对复杂,因为它涉及到多个因素,云服务提供商可能根据实例类型(如通用型、计算型、内存型等)、使用时长、数据存储量等收费,以阿里云的ECS(弹性计算服务)为例,通用型实例的价格根据不同的配置(CPU、内存等)从几十元到数千元每月不等,如果使用了对象存储(如OSS)、数据库服务(如RDS)等附加服务,还需要额外付费,云服务提供商可能会有一些优惠活动,如长期使用折扣、新用户优惠等,这些都需要在成本计算时考虑进去。
3、专用服务器租赁
- 专用服务器租赁是指企业租赁整台服务器专门用于自己的业务,这种租赁模式的成本主要取决于服务器的配置和租赁时长,与云服务器租赁不同,专用服务器租赁通常提供更高的定制性,企业可以要求租赁公司按照特定的配置(如特定的CPU型号、大容量内存和高速存储等)组装服务器并进行租赁,专用服务器租赁的月成本可能在数千元到数万元不等,具体取决于服务器的高端程度和租赁时长。
案例分析
1、小型电商网站
- 假设一个小型电商网站,预计每天有1000 - 2000独立访客,平均页面大小为2MB,其性能需求主要集中在网络带宽、一定的CPU计算能力和适量的内存。
- 网络带宽:按照每个访客平均打开5个页面计算,每天的流量约为(1000×5×2MB)+(1000×5×2MB)=20GB(取中间值1500访客计算),每月流量约为600GB,考虑到一定的冗余,选择100Mbps带宽足够,月费用约为1000元。
- CPU和内存:选择一个中低端的云服务器实例,如2核心CPU、8GB内存的通用型实例,月费用约为500元。
- 软件方面:采用Linux操作系统(免费),数据库使用MySQL(开源免费),不需要额外的软件许可证费用。
- 总成本:每月约1500元。
2、大型企业级应用
- 以一个大型企业的ERP系统为例,该系统需要处理大量的业务数据,对服务器的性能要求极高。
- 硬件配置:选择高端的机架式服务器,配置为16核心CPU、128GB内存、大容量SSD存储(RAID 5阵列),硬件购置成本约为10万元,按照3年租赁期计算,每月硬件租赁成本约为2778元。
- 软件方面:采用Windows Server Enterprise版操作系统,许可证费用为1.5万元,按3年计算,月软件成本约为417元,ERP软件许可证费用较高,假设每月分摊费用为5000元。
- 网络带宽:由于企业内部多个分支机构访问,需要1Gbps带宽,月费用为3000元,另外需要10个额外IP地址,月费用为500元。
- 总成本:每月约11695元。
服务器租赁计算是一个复杂的过程,涉及到硬件、软件、网络等多个方面的成本计算以及性能与成本的权衡,在租赁服务器时,企业和创业者需要根据自身的业务需求,准确预估性能要求,选择合适的租赁模式(传统托管、云租赁或专用服务器租赁),并合理计算成本,通过深入了解服务器租赁计算的各个环节,可以在满足业务需求的同时,最大程度地降低成本,提高资源利用率,从而为企业的数字化发展提供有力的支持,无论是小型企业的起步阶段,还是大型企业的数字化转型过程中,正确的服务器租赁决策都将对业务的成功与否产生重要影响。
本文链接:https://www.zhitaoyun.cn/104346.html
发表评论